WebIf we represent conductivity by σ(greek sigma) and resistivity by ρ(greek rho) their relation is given by: σ = 1 / ρ. The nanoOhm-meter nΩ.m (billionths of ohm-meter) is costumarily used to express resistivity in metals. For conductivity the MegaSiemens per meter MS/m (millions of Siemens per meter) is the unit of choice. Web8 mei 2024 · Conduction: Metals are good conductors because they have free electrons. Web21 mrt. 2024 · metals, which are very good conductors (specific resistance of 10 −8 Ω·m), semiconductors (10 −6 Ω·m),*, and insulators (10 10 – 10 16 Ω·m). Electrical … • A conductor such as a metal has high conductivity and a low resistivity. • An insulator like glass has low conductivity and a high resistivity. • The conductivity of a semiconductor is generally intermediate, but varies widely under different conditions, such as exposure of the material to electric fields or specific frequencies of light, and, most important, with temperature and composition of the semiconductor material.
WebConductivity is the reciprocal (inverse) of electrical resistivity.
